I have an old verizon iPhone 4 that has the grandfathered unlimited data plan... can I buy a iPhone 6 outright and add it to my plan ( I think another line was $10) and use the unlimited data on both phones?
 
No the unlimited is tied to the line is is currently on. You can add the phone and swap phones. Then you'd have one on unlimited, the 6, and one on a regular data plan.
 
There was some sort of loophole where you could add unlimited data to additional lines when starting a new line. But you still have to pay the unlimited data per line. Unsure if they closed it or what, but there was an ongoing thread about it.
 
The unlimited plan is tied to the SIM card. Not the phone. Buy the phone outright, replace the SIM card that has the unlimited data acct and you are good to go. I have done this many times.
